// this is an interpolation optimization: when tmp is "{{}}" or "{{..}}" then no need
// going through the entire interpolation (which is quite expensive), instead indicate
// (via returning the special symbol TKN_EMP + key) that json can be taken directly
// from the iterator or a namespace and hence skip interpolations and following parsing
auto opn = tmp.find(ibv.front().ITRP_OPN); // find opening "{{"
if(opn != std::string::npos and tmp.find_first_not_of(" ", 0) == opn) { // tmb begins with "{{"
auto cls = tmp.find(ibv.front().ITRP_CLS); // find closing "}}"
if(cls != std::string::npos) {
std::string key = tmp.substr(opn + 2, cls - opn - 2); // extract key between {{..}}
if(key.empty()) { tmp = TKN_EMP; return tmp; } // key is empty (i.e. {{}})
auto found = ns.find(key);
if(found != ns.end() and found->KEY.front() != '$') // key does not begin with $
{ tmp = TKN_EMP + key; return tmp; }
}
}
